Product description

This is a 2025 Reissue released as a LP.

Appetite for Destruction is the explosive debut studio album from American hard rock titans, Guns N' Roses, unleashed onto the world on 21 July 1987 via Geffen Records. Despite an initially modest reception, this 53-minute masterclass in raw, unadulterated rock would soon become a cultural phenomenon, catapulting the band to global stardom.

The album's title track, 'Welcome to the Jungle', sets the tone with its frenetic energy and Axl Rose's distinctive, powerful vocals. From there, the band tears through a collection of hard rock anthems that showcase their signature blend of glam metal, classic rock, and hard rock influences. Standout tracks like 'Sweet Child o' Mine', 'Paradise City', and 'Nightrain' are testament to the band's songwriting prowess and musical virtuosity, with each song a testament to the raw, unfiltered energy that defined the era.

'Appetite for Destruction' is not just an album; it's a snapshot of a band on the brink of superstardom, capturing the essence of Los Angeles' seedy underbelly and the hedonistic lifestyle that accompanied it. The album's gritty, unpolished production only serves to enhance its raw appeal, making it a timeless classic that continues to resonate with rock fans today.

With over 28 million copies sold worldwide and an 18-times platinum certification from the RIAA, 'Appetite for Destruction' is not just a debut album; it's a statement of intent from a band that would go on to redefine the landscape of rock music. From the blistering guitar riffs of Slash to the thunderous drumming of Steven Adler, every member of Guns N' Roses brings their A-game, resulting in an album that is as powerful and enduring as the band itself.

About Guns N' Roses

Guns N' Roses, the iconic American hard rock band, burst onto the scene in 1985 with a raw, gritty sound that would redefine the genre. Hailing from Los Angeles, the band's classic lineup—featuring the powerful vocals of Axl Rose, the legendary guitar solos of Slash, and a rhythm section that included Izzy Stradlin, Duff McKagan, and Steven Adler—quickly gained a reputation for their high-energy performances and rebellious attitude.
